		<description><![CDATA[Banner Life has some of the best term rates available.  it is my understanding that one feature not found on their term product is the ability to convert the term to whole life, should you chose to at a later date.  If that conversion is not important to you, then Banner Life would be a good choice.  Long story short, should the need arise, Banner has the financial strength to pay the death benefit.]]></description>

		<description><![CDATA[Banner Life Insurance Company is a very strong company and one of many I do represent and sell. They are part of the William Penn Co. of NY and reside out of Maryland. Banner is an A+ rated company by A.M. Best, and AA- (very strong) with Standard &#038; Poor&#039;s. They approach $6 billion in assets and are approaching $600 billion of in force life insurance. I am very comfortable with the carrier and their customer service.]]></description>
